THREE-AXIS OPTICAL-ELECTRONIC AUTOCOLLIMATOR WITH INCREASED SENSITIVITY OF THE ROLL ANGLE MEASURING

Abstract

A three-axis optical-electronic autocollimator with a tetrahedral reflector wherein two dihedral angles between
facets have a small deviation from 90° is considered in the paper. It is established that such reflector allows to make independent measurements of the roll angle. The ways of autocollimator sensitivity increase while roll angle measuring are determined. The analysis of parameters of the three-axis optical-electronic autocollimator with increased roll angle measurement sensitivity is made.
